What is the average price of a house in M22?

The average price for a house in M22 is £299k, costing on average £327 per sqft.

Average prices of houses by bedroom count are: £246k for a two-bedroom, £277k for a three-bedroom, £446k for a four-bedroom, and £0 for a five-bedroom.

What share of houses in M22 feature gardens and parking?

In M22, 96% of houses have a garden and 89% include parking.

What is the breakdown of property types in M22?

The housing mix in M22 is 2% detached, 50% semi-detached, 48% terraced, and 0% other.

What is the average price of a flat in M22?

The average price for a flat in M22 is £174k, costing on average £261 per sqft.

Average prices of flats by bedroom count are: £145k for a one-bedroom, £175k for a two-bedroom, £0 for a three-bedroom, and £0 for a four-bedroom.

What share of flats in M22 feature balconies and parking?

In M22, 25% of flats have a balcony and 100% include parking.

What is the breakdown of lease types in M22?

The leasing mix in M22 is 100% leasehold and 0% freehold.
